In 1692, Edmund Scarborough entered the world in Accomac, Accomack, Virginia, United States, born to Colonel Edmund Scarborough And Elizabeth Edwards. Edmund Scarborough married Priscilla Meredith, and had children including Ruth Meredith Scarborough Little. Edmund Scarborough passed away in 1753 in York, Virginia, United States.
